The chimney flue is the interior shaft that vents smoke and also gases which are created by burning a fire in the fire place. Damage to the flue, cracks between the bricks, and weakening mortar occur after years of use. In cases of light to moderate damage, it's feasible to repair the loosened mortar and cracks. Adding a chimney liner or relining your chimney can help shield your flue from damage and prevent fires. The 3 major kinds of liners are metal, clay, and cast-in-place liners.
Metal liners are a recently preferred type of chimney liner for upgrades and also repair services. They are typically produced from stainless steel, although they can sometimes be made from aluminum also. Metal liners are are really versatile, readily available in stiff or flexible models, and most any kind of house can accommodate them.
Clay tile liners are one of the most common kind of chimney liner. A lot of older houses have clay liners. They are fairly economical, but need routine maintenance to see to it that flue tiles do not crack, split, or break.
Cast in place liners are a light material comparable to cement that is installed inside the chimney for a seamless flue. These sorts of liners often tend to be difficult to. install and also expensive. With time, they can begin to develop cracks and require relining.

The chimney crown is very crucial. It functions as a protective concrete umbrella or rooftop for your whole chimney. This safeguards your flue and chimney from rain and other elements.
When the chimney crown gets cracks or ends up being damaged in any way, it permits rain water seep through the chimney and expand and contract. This can create serious damage to the entire chimney if not fixed. When discovered early, standard repairs can be made to prevent issues from occurring.
If cracking in the chimney crown is small, the splits can be loaded with patch and a waterproof sealer can be used on top. This will securely prevent water from entering.
In scenarios where there is more substantial damage to the crown, it may be needed to rebuild it. If the chimney is still in good condition, then it's feasible to rebuild just the crown. This will protect the chimney for a lot more years. It's important to have a professional chimney repair inspect the crown, flue, and entire chimney to make sure all areas are safe.
A chimney cap protects your home in numerous ways. It keeps rain, snow, and, dirt and animals out of your fire place and protects against hot sparks as well as embers from flying out and into your roof. You should never run your fire place or wood burning stove without a chimney cap.
Chimney caps are constructed from galvanized or stainless steel, light weight aluminum, or copper. Our chimney service professionals can replace your chimney cap or mount a new one on your chimney if you do not have one yet.
Many people confuse the chimney damper with the flue. The flue is the inside of the chimney that smoke journeys through. The damper is the portion of the chimney that shuts off air flow to the exterior. When a damper becomes old, it requires repair work. Generally fixing or changing the existing old metal damper can be expensive.
It's far better to mount a top sealing damper. They are cheaper, and every effective. A top sealing damper will keep cold drafts and also unwanted weather outdoors. A considerable amount of airflow can leak in through the chimney from the outside, making your house feel colder in the winter season. This can quickly add up to hundreds of dollars per year in extra heating expenses.

The firebox is the area inside the fireplace where the fire burns. This portion of of the fire place can sometimes require repair services. Firebox tuckpointing is a process that gets rid of old mortar joints. The surface between the joints is cleaned up, and after that the old joints are filled with new cement. Fractured or loosened bricks can additionally be fixed.
Prefabricated fireplaces have refractory panels. These panels are repaired by cutting and sizing replacement panels, fitting them together and mounting them.
